For a person with Bipolor Disorder it can be twice as
fast and sometimes your mind
is so complex during and episode you feel as if you can't
sort out any of your thoughts
and make sense out of them.
I was diagnosed in 1996 with this illness and since then I have had my ups and downs,  But sometimes little things can make my symptoms come back, I guess they never leave they are just not as dominent they stay in the background. Medicine is a key factor in helping to relieve some of the symptoms but really talking to others who have it too can be very helpful.

Some Symptoms of Mania                       

Elevated Mood, expansive,
or irritable.

Increased Activity and Restlesness

Pressured speech that is loud.

Thoughts that race.

Decreased need for sleep.

Inflated self-esteem or grandiosity.

Spending sprees with no regard to
personal expense.


Some Symptoms of Depression


Sadness

Flat or muted mood

Hopelessness

Helplessness

Irritability

Numbness

Thoughts of not wanting to go on
living.

Loss of interest in everyday
activities.
